teemusss (no signature)let's be more objective.W&F is much better than Active Camera in Spot plane view ONLY, not in virtual cockpit (especially because there are no head movements, no automatic tracking and padlock). I have both utilities and I'm very happy. I disable the VC walk around in W&F so I can use other AC functionalities and I can call anytime W&F spot view.All in all AC offers more features than W&F.
